ETS is the acronym for environmental tobacco smoke, otherwise known as secondary, or residual, smoke. Studies on the health consequences of ETS are not so numerous as those on active smoking, but the results indicate similar negative effects. This little volume condenses the statistical information into lay language, provides a form to assess one's exposure to ETS, and suggests ways and means to eliminate it from one's world. Several examples of policies from a variety of governmental units in the United States and Canada are cited. A handy introduction to the topic, although pricey.Sondra Brunhumer, Westen Michigan Univ.
